Named after his daughter, fruit for ‘Marylou’ comes from 45-year-old vines rooted in granite soils and is naturally vinified. The wine is everything you want from a bottle of Bojo Villages: it’s light, it’s bright, and it’s downright chuggable. Serve chilled.
